PALS Online: Revolutionizing Pediatric Advanced Life Support Training
In the ever-evolving field of healthcare, staying updated with the latest life-saving techniques and protocols is paramount, especially in the case of pediatric emergencies.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) training equips healthcare providers with the knowledge and skills necessary to effectively manage critical situations involving infants and children. The
content of PALS Online is comprehensive and up to date with the latest
guidelines and protocols established by organizations such as the
American Heart Association (AHA). The program covers a wide range of
topics including pediatric assessment, airway management, cardiac arrest
management, electrical therapies, pharmacology, and more. Through
interactive modules, engaging videos, simulations, and quizzes,
healthcare providers are guided through each topic, allowing for active
learning and knowledge retention.
